Ali Nahvi is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Experimental and Cognitive Psychology and Control and Systems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Ali Nahvi has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 836 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Social Psychology, 20 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ology and 19 papers in Control and Systems Engineering. Recurrent topics in Ali Nahvi’s work include Sleep and Work-Related Fatigue (19 papers), Teleoperation and Haptic Systems (12 papers) and Ergonomics and Musculoskeletal Disorders (11 papers). Ali Nahvi is often cited by papers focused on Sleep and Work-Related Fatigue (19 papers), Teleoperation and Haptic Systems (12 papers) and Ergonomics and Musculoskeletal Disorders (11 papers). Ali Nahvi coll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Austria. Ali Nahvi's co-authors include John M. Hollerbach, S. Ali A. Moosavian, H. Naseri, Shahram Azadi and Adel Mazloumi and has published in prestigious journals such as Sensors, International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health and SAE technical papers on CD-ROM/SAE technical paper series.
